How to Make Swirled Easter Cake

Ingredients:

  • 1 box of cake mix (any flavor)
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up of vegetable oil
  • 1 cup of water
  • Food coloring (various colors)
  • 1 cup of unsalted butter, softened
  • 4 cups of powdered sugar
  • 2 tablespoons of milk
  • 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ract

Directions:

  1. Preheat the oven according to the cake mix instructions. Grease and flour two round cake pans.
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ine the cake mix, eggs, oil, and water. Mix until smooth.
  3. Divide the batter into separate bowls and add food coloring to each to create different colors.
  4. Alternate spooning the colored batter into the prepared pans to create a swirled effect.
  5. Bake according to cake mix instructions. Let the cakes cool completely.
  6. In another bowl, beat the softened butter until creamy. Gradually add pow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la extract, mixing until smooth to make the buttercream frosting.
  7. Frost the cooled cakes with the buttercream, decorating as desired.

How to Store Swirled Easter Cake

You can keep the Swirled Easter Cake in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. If you want it to last longer, store it in the fridge for about a week. Just make sure to bring it back to room temperature before serving for the best taste.

Tips to Make Swirled Easter Cake

  • For a more vibrant cake, use more food coloring in your batter.
  • Make sure the cakes are completely cool before frosting to avoid melting the buttercream.
  • You can also add a layer of fruit jam between the cake layers for extra flavor!

Variation

If you want to switch things up, try using different flavors of cake mix. Lemon or vanilla cake mix pairs well with bright colors! You can also add lemon zest to the frosting for a fresh twist.

FAQs

1. Can I use homemade cake instead of box cake mix?
Yes, you can! Just make sure to follow your favorite cake recipe to keep the texture and taste just right.

2. What food coloring works best?
Gel food coloring is best for intense colors, but liquid food coloring also works if that’s what you have on hand.

3. How can I make this cake gluten-free?
Use a gluten-free cake mix instead of regular cake mix to make this cake suitable for those with gluten sensitivities.
